The first impression
21 by CoSTUME NATIONAL is a Woody Floral Musk fragrance for women and men. 21 was launched in 2007. 21 was created by IFF and Juliette Karagueuzoglou. Top notes are Milk, Amber, Saffron, Cashmere Wood and Orange Blossom; middle notes are Caraway, Pepper, Labdanum, Oakmoss and Bergamot; base notes are Patchouli, Vanilla, Tonka Bean, Clary Sage, Musk, Cedar and Vetiver.

The perfumer behind it
IFF
IFF is a major international fragrance and flavor company, not an individual perfumer. Their team of perfumers has created fragrances for brands such as Alviero Martini, Avon, and BARRIO. Notable creations include 1a Classe Woman, Geo Donna, Slip Into, Surreal Love Garden, Chaos, and In The Air.
